Software Engineering Manager compensation in United States at Carta ranges from $347K per year for M5 to $442K per year for M6. The median yearly compensation package in United States totals $450K. At Carta, RSUs are subject to a 4-year vesting schedule:
25% vests in the 1st-YR (25.00% annually)
25% vests in the 2nd-YR (2.08% monthly)
25% vests in the 3rd-YR (2.08% monthly)
25% vests in the 4th-YR (2.08% monthly)

What are the Software Engineering Manager levels at Carta?
Levels.fyi has reported pay for 2 Software Engineering Manager levels at Carta, from M5 (entry) up to M6: M5, M6. Levels.fyi lists median pay for each of these levels.
What is the starting salary for a Software Engineering Manager at Carta?
The entry level for Software Engineering Managers at Carta is M5. Median total compensation at M5 is $347,101 per year in United States.
